⚒️ What Gear Works Best Where?
🏖️ Beach Terrain (Soft Sand, Coastal Driving)
-
Recovery Tracks: Lightweight and easy to deploy when bogged in soft sand
-
Tyre Deflators: Lower pressure = more traction
-
Shovels & Soft Shackles: For quick digging and fast recovery
-
Lighting: Wide beam lights for open areas and shoreline visibility
-
Storage Tip: Keep gear easily accessible; quick recoveries are key on beaches
🌲 Bush Terrain (Muddy Trails, Forest Paths)
-
Snatch Straps & Tree Savers: For pulling out of tight forest tracks
-
Winches & Pulleys: Especially helpful when you're alone or in a remote area
-
High-Lift Jack & Base Plate: To lift your vehicle on uneven terrain
-
Lighting: Spot beams to cut through dense underbrush at night
-
Tie-Down Systems: Heavy-duty straps to keep recovery gear secure over bumps
